
Introduced in 1986, the BMW M5 is the high performance variance of BMW 5 series of executive cars. Manufactured by BMW s in-house motorsport division BMW M, the first incarnation of the M5 was derived from a M535i and was hand built. It became the fasted production sedan in the world at the time of it arrival. Since its introduction, it has gone through five production generations, with the latest one being the F30 M5 which was unveiled in the 2011 Paris Motor Show.

How do I change the air filter on a BMW M5?
To change the air filter on a BMW M5, first locate the air filter housing which is usually located on the passenger side of the engine. Remove the clips holding the housing cover in place and then lift the cover off. Remove the old filter, clean the housing, and replace the filter with a new one before reassembling the housing cover.
How do I replace the battery on a BMW M5?
To replace the battery on a BMW M5, first remove the negative terminal cable and then the positive terminal cable from the battery. Remove the battery hold-down bracket and then lift the battery out of the car. Install the new battery, reattach the hold-down bracket, and then reconnect the positive and negative cables.
How do I replace the brake pads on a BMW M5?
To replace the brake pads on a BMW M5, first remove the wheels and unbolt the caliper from the rotor. Remove the old brake pads and replace them with new ones. It is important to properly torque the caliper bolts and follow the proper bed-in procedure for the new brake pads to ensure optimal performance.
How do I replace the cabin air filter on a BMW M5?
To replace the cabin air filter on a BMW M5, first locate the filter housing which is usually located under the dashboard on the passenger side. Remove the housing cover and then remove the old filter. Clean the housing and replace the filter with a new one before reassembling the cover.
How do I replace the fuel filter on a BMW M5?
To replace the fuel filter on a BMW M5, first locate the filter which is usually located underneath the car near the fuel tank. Release the fuel pressure by removing the fuel pump fuse and then start the engine until it stalls. Remove the old filter and replace it with a new one before reattaching the fuel lines and starting the engine.
How do I replace the headlight bulb on a BMW M5?
To replace the headlight bulb on a BMW M5, first remove the headlight assembly by releasing the clips or bolts holding it in place. Remove the bulb by twisting it counterclockwise and then replace it with a new one. It is important to properly seat the new bulb and reattach the headlight assembly before testing the new bulb.
How do I replace the serpentine belt on a BMW M5?
To replace the serpentine belt on a BMW M5, first locate the belt tensioner and use a wrench or socket to release the tension on the belt. Remove the old belt and replace it with a new one. It is important to properly route the new belt and tension it correctly to ensure optimal performance and prevent belt failure.
